FastLed 2.1 - added saturation to ColorFromPalette (colorutils.cpp)
/* use this code in Arduino
for (int i=0; i <NUM_LEDS; i++)
{ leds[i] = ColorFromPalette( currentPalette, map(i, 0, NUM_LEDS, 0, 255), brightness, map(i, 0, NUM_LEDS, 0, 255));
}
*/
// blend doesn't seem to be implemented/necessary in CRGBPalette, so I left it out
// Probably this can be optimized? See questions in comments.
CRGB ColorFromPalette( const CRGBPalette256& pal, uint8_t index, uint8_t brightness, uint8_t saturation)
{
const CRGB* entry = &(pal[0]) + index;
uint8_t red = entry->red;
uint8_t green = entry->green;
uint8_t blue = entry->blue;
// added manipulation of saturation
// variables need to become externally accessible
// just for testing
uint8_t maxSaturation = 255;
uint8_t minSaturation = 0;
// scale saturation in the right range.
// and inverse the value (255-saturation)
saturation = lerp8by8(255 - maxSaturation, 255 - minSaturation, 255 - saturation);
// make saturation appear linear
// I picked now raw, since we we won't have issues like with dimming brightness:
// https://plus.google.com/112889495015752015404/posts/UGXWJtFvz61
saturation = dim8_raw(saturation);
// apply saturation
// qadd8 works faster? Because we just add saturation
red = lerp8by8(red , 255, saturation);
green = lerp8by8(green, 255, saturation);
blue = lerp8by8(blue , 255, saturation);
if( brightness != 255) {
nscale8x3_video( red, green, blue, brightness);
}
return CRGB( red, green, blue);
}
